Business operators plan vigil to force authorities to enforce relocation of refugees to Dzaleka

Small-scale business operators have disclosed a plan to hold a vigil on 16th march 2023 at Capital Hill in Lilongwe to force the Malawi Government to relocate the refugees and asylum seekers back to Dzaleka Refugee Camp in Dowa.
